01 FRAMING
Hackathon prototype
OneFlow was built for PPG AEN Hackathon 2026, Challenge 4 (Team Error 404). It is a working Next.js demo with synthetic personas and simulated automation — not an officially deployed production employee platform, and not a Workday replacement.
02 CHALLENGE
What we set out to solve
Onboarding, offboarding, workplace admin, access provisioning and resource management were fragmented across teams and systems. The challenge asked for end-to-end lifecycle visibility, less admin load and clearer compliance/access governance — at prototype depth, without claiming measured ROI.
03 JOURNEY
Employee and admin experience
- 01Mock Workday trigger
Demo directory where hire/exit status changes create lifecycle cases in OneFlow — no live Workday API.
- 02Employee onboarding
Guided first-day journey: readiness countdown, tasks, induction and access-card forms, inbox and profile.
- 03Employee offboarding
Exit clearance journey with remaining actions and last-working-day visibility.
- 04Role task queues
HR, IT Security, onsite IT, facilities, hiring manager, finance and related roles see owned work — not a single shared inbox.
- 05Admin dashboard
Volumes, overdue items, Needs Attention, lifecycle cases, templates, reports and demo reset controls.
- 06Simulated automation
Automation runs are simulated locally. A “Live” mode is an explicit Phase 2 stub — integrations are not connected.

05 ARCHITECTURE
Prototype approach
The UI is Next.js App Router. A DataService facade persists to browser localStorage — not Dataverse. Auth is demo email/password in client session storage. Optional AWS SES exists only for demo mail delivery. A documented Microsoft production path (Entra, Dataverse, Power Automate, Power BI) is proposal-only.

07 OUTCOME
What the prototype proves
OneFlow validates an operating model: Workday as source of event, OneFlow as orchestration for cases, role-owned tasks and employee journeys. It does not measure lead-time or satisfaction KPIs, and it does not connect to live enterprise systems. The public demo remains labeled as mock data with simulated automation.
